January 3, 2018—KB4056898 (Security-only update)
Applies to: Windows 8.1, Windows Server 2012 R2 Standard
Improvements and fixes
This security update includes quality improvements. No new operating system features are being introduced in this update. Key changes include:
For more information about the resolved security vulnerabilities, see the Security Update Guide.
- Security updates to Windows SMB Server, Windows Kernel, Windows Datacenter Networking, and Windows Graphics.
Known issues in this update
Symptom Workaround When calling CoInitializeSecurity, the call will fail if passing RPC_C_IMP_LEVEL_NONE under certain conditions. Microsoft is working on a resolution and will provide an update in an upcoming release. Due to an issue with some versions of Anti-Virus software, this fix is only being made applicable to the machines where the Anti virus ISV have updated the ALLOW REGKEY. Contact your Anti-Virus AV to confirm that their software is compatible and have set the following REGKEY on the machine
Key="H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E"Subkey="SOFTWARE\Microsoft\Windows\CurrentVersion\QualityCompat"
Value Name="cadca5fe-87d3-4b96-b7fb-a231484277cc"
Type="REG_DWORD”
Data="0x00000000”
How to get this update
This update will be downloaded and installed automatically from Windows Update. To get the standalone package for this update, go to the Microsoft Update Catalog website.
